A collection of apothegmes or sayings of the ancients, collected out of Plutarch, Diogenes Laertius, Elian, Atheneus, Stobeius, Macrobius, Erasmus, and others. Wherein, the manners and customs of the Greeks, Romans and Lacedemonians, are represented. To which is added a collection of pleasant apothegmes, or sayings from several modern authors.
